In the beautiful Idaho countryside, our Inn is in the beloved year-round recreation hotspot called Heise-Kelly Canyon. We have a wide variety of rooms and sites. Including: 4 log cabins that sleep 4 in 2 queen log beds with mini kitchenettes, 3 sources of heat, and en suite bathrooms 4 Moonlight Cottages with AC and heat that sleep 5 or 6 in 2 queens plus one adult friendly twin (cottages B and D) or two kid-friendly twins bunked together (cottages A and C), mini-kitchenettes, and just a few steps away is the deluxe no-fee Loo-uvre Restroom and Shower House Two 20' diameter year-round yurts with themed decor-- each sleeps 4 in one queen and two twins with all bed and bath linens, plus a very well-stocked kitchen, and a firepit, pergola, picnic table and Char-griller charcoal BBQ outside. Camper trailer-- 16' vintage camper Little Buffy that sleeps 2 and has a mini-kitchenette and guests use the Loo-uvre Restroom/Shower House close by. New to the Lodge is Adirondack-style "The Bunkie" that sleeps 6 or 7 plus has a desk, microwave and fridge. All bed and bath linens are provided in all of our rooms. Firepits are a-plenty! Our Inn also has great tent sites, plus both 30 amp and 50 amp RV/Camper sites with water and electric, a firepit and picnic table each, plus a fee dump station. Since opening in June 2020, our guests have loved everything about our unique, themed Moonlight Cottages. A slightly campy but very comfortable stay. Our four Moonlight Cottages were built by the Amish in Salmon, Idaho, and have fun themes and curated decor-- A:"Ananda" yoga bliss, B: "Hoot" campy, C: "Howdy" western, and D: "Schuss" ski. Each has a feature wall-- Ananda has a venetian plastered wall with a large Nigel May Photography "Teton Sunrise" picture, Hoot and Schuss have hand-painted paint-by-number full wall murals, and Howdy has a bark-on chinked log wall with a John Hart original oil painting. A retro microwave and a fridge, 2 luscious queen beds, plus 1 twin bed (A and C) or 2 twin beds bunked (B and D). Spacious and airy, the Moonlight Cottages have two sources of heat for cooler months, and A/C for the summer months. Cottage guests use the very close by Loo-euvre Restroom and Shower House with a well-lit short path from each cottage. The Cottage Courtyard has a picnic table and a charcoal/wood grill. Bear World is 15 minutes to northwest, Heise Hot Springs/Zipline/9-Hole Golf 1.2 miles up canyon, Cress Creek Creek Nature Trail 1.3 miles away, and Labelle Lake Ice Palace 12 miles to northwest (December through February). Scenic and whitewater rafting is 90 minutes to Jackson, down the world famous Class 3-4 "Hoback" section of the Snake River. We are located between Idaho Falls, Idaho, and Jackson, Wyoming. Our Inn is on Butler Island, with the Snake River on one side and the Great Feeder Canal (formerly known as The Dry Bed which was the Snake's natural spring overflow for centuries). Hot springs facility, 9 hole golf, driving range, mini golf, XC and alpine skiing, hiking, world class fishing-- all very close by or within 4 miles.
